The Angel's Keening

Contributed by Deleterious_Dislike on Monday, 28th February 2005 @ 04:06:17 PM in AEST
Topic: DarkPoetry



Take a deep breath and allow me to elucidate.
Suck on it hard and soon-enough you'll hallucinate.
Let me lick it up clean, that blood from your plate,
lap it up, swallow then crown you my mate.

Shake it down, squezze me I'm here to be bent.
Turn it up, please me, for all that I've spent.
Turn me round, beat me I shall be your vent.
Open yours, believe me, here's my lament.

Now lead me to the yard and leave me to decay,
I want to be alone to rot , so leave me there to stay.
My music dies, along with love, no longer will it play.
I concur to fate, for it is mine, it has to be this way.

So i take to shadows eye's, I follow into night.
His icy fingers beckon me and tell me not to fight.
I can hear the angels keening as I wonder out of sight.
My eyes,
they burn,
my heart,
stands still,
as I walk further from the light.
